CSS中的cursor屬性是用于設(shè)置鼠標(biāo)指針在元素上的樣式,其功能是為了增加網(wǎng)頁(yè)的交互性,提高用戶的使用體驗(yàn)。
例:cursor:pointer;
上述代碼就是將元素的鼠標(biāo)指針設(shè)置為手型,當(dāng)鼠標(biāo)懸停在該元素上時(shí),鼠標(biāo)指針會(huì)變成小手的形狀。
下面是一些常用的cursor屬性取值和相應(yīng)的鼠標(biāo)指針樣式:
cursor:auto; //默認(rèn)指針 cursor:pointer; //手型指針 cursor:default; //默認(rèn)指針 cursor:move; //移動(dòng)指針 cursor:text; //文字光標(biāo) cursor:wait; //等待指針 cursor:not-allowed; //禁止指針
除了這些常用的屬性取值,還可以使用自定義的圖片來(lái)設(shè)置鼠標(biāo)指針的樣式,例:
.cursor { cursor:url('cursor.png'),auto; }
上述代碼中,通過(guò)指定圖片的URL路徑來(lái)設(shè)置鼠標(biāo)指針樣式,如果指定的圖片不能正常顯示,那么默認(rèn)的指針樣式就會(huì)生效。
在實(shí)際開(kāi)發(fā)中,我們可以根據(jù)不同的交互需求來(lái)設(shè)置鼠標(biāo)指針的樣式,從而增加用戶對(duì)網(wǎng)頁(yè)的體驗(yàn)。